Positioned on the second floor of The Factory on Nile Street, this exceptional two-bedroom loft apartment offers a vast open-plan living space, rich in industrial character.

Spanning an impressive 1,253 sq. ft, the property features striking exposed brickwork, Crittall-style factory windows, and warm hardwood flooring. A private terrace overlooks the tranquil central courtyard, while east and west-facing windows flood the space with natural light.

At the heart of the apartment is a spectacular open-plan reception, dining, and kitchen area—a versatile space that perfectly embodies loft living. The high ceilings and large factory windows enhance the sense of volume, creating an airy yet inviting environment for both everyday living and entertaining. The two bedrooms are generously proportioned, while the main bathroom and additional ensuite are finished to a high standard.

The Factory was developed by the Manhattan Loft Corporation in 1997, playing a key role in redefining London loft living. Originally an industrial building, it retains its warehouse aesthetic with raw textures and expansive interiors. Residents benefit from a well-maintained communal courtyard and a secure entry system.

Perfectly positioned between Old Street and Islington, the location offers excellent transport links while remaining close to green spaces and the waterways of the City Basin and Regent’s Canal. The nearby Wenlock Arms, overlooking the charming Shepherdess Walk Park, is a local favourite, while the Narrow Boat pub on the canal provides a scenic spot for a drink. From here, it’s easy to explore the vibrant cafes along the canal, including the beloved Towpath Café, or head west to King’s Cross and Camden for a wider range of dining and cultural attractions.

Being sold chain-free with a share of the freehold, this is a rare opportunity to secure a true warehouse-style in one of East London’s premiere building.
